Cy Schubert - ITSD Open Systems Group <Cy.Schubert@uumail.gov.bc.ca> writes:
> In message <xzpu26gq7nk.fsf@flood.ping.uio.no>, Dag-Erling Smorgrav 
> writes:
> > Hmm, I've had a CFP1080S (Antigua) for years, and never experienced
> > any trouble at all with it. [...]
> I've got the same drive.  Attached to a 1542B it works fine.  Attached 
> to a 2940U the filesystem is corrupted within minutes.

I have it on a 2940UW (factory default settings, except maybe for >1GB
support) which it shares with a Quantum Atlas II (XP4550W) and a
Tecmar Travan streamer. Never any trouble. I can mail you a dmesg when
I get home later tonight.
